Utilise le code SPRING20 pour 20% de réduction sur tout module individuel. Voir les modules →

Documentation CRM Chat Pro

Pour commencer

Suis ces étapes pour configurer CRM Chat Pro.

Installer le module

Téléverse le fichier zip de CRM Chat Pro via Configuration > Modules > Installer un nouveau module. Complète l'assistant de configuration avec ta clé de licence et active le module.

Installer le module

Configurer les permissions

Va dans Configuration > Staff > Rôles et définis les permissions de chat pour chaque rôle : accès au chat, création de groupes, suppression de messages et conversion en ticket.

Configurer les permissions

Démarrer ton première conversation

Ouvre la page Chat depuis le menu principal. Clique sur n'importe quel membre du staff pour démarrer une conversation directe, ou clique sur « Nouveau groupe » pour créer une discussion de groupe.

Démarrer ton première conversation

Personnaliser les paramètres

Va dans Configuration > Paramètres CRM Chat pour configurer les limites de téléversement, les types de fichiers autorisés, les paramètres de transport en temps réel et les sons de notification.

Personnaliser les paramètres

Download Diagnostics Report

If you need support, go to the module admin page and click the "Download Diagnostics" link. This generates a JSON file with system info, PHP version, installed modules, and recent errors (secrets are automatically redacted). Upload this file when creating a support ticket at custom-perfexcrm.com/support/ for faster troubleshooting.

Download Diagnostics Report

Trucs et astuces

Tire le meilleur parti de CRM Chat Pro avec ces conseils.

Utilise Pusher pour les grandes équipes

Si tu as Pusher configuré dans Perfex CRM, CRM Chat le détecte automatiquement et utilise les WebSockets pour une livraison instantanée des messages. Cela réduit la charge serveur et améliore les performances pour les équipes avec de nombreux utilisateurs simultanés.

Déplace le widget en cas de chevauchement

Si le widget de chat masque un bouton, déplace-le simplement par glisser-déposer. La position est sauvegardée dans ton navigateur et persiste après le rechargement de la page.

Convertis les discussions en tickets

Lorsqu'une discussion de chat mène à une action, sélectionne les messages pertinents et convertis-les en ticket de support. Cela garantit que rien ne passe entre les mailles du filet.

Convert discussions to tickets

When a chat discussion leads to an action item, convert the messages to a support ticket with one click. Context is preserved automatically.

Reposition the widget

If the chat widget overlaps a button, drag it to a new position. The position is saved in your browser and stays across page reloads. To reset, clear the browser localStorage key or use the widget context menu.

Use diagnostics for faster support

When creating a support ticket, download and attach the diagnostics report from your module settings. It contains system info, PHP version, database details, and recent errors — all with secrets automatically redacted. This helps resolve your issue much faster.

Questions fréquentes

CRM Chat nécessite-t-il des services externes ?

Non. CRM Chat est 100 % auto-hébergé et fonctionne immédiatement avec les Server-Sent Events (SSE). Si tu as déjà Pusher configuré dans Perfex CRM, il utilisera automatiquement les WebSockets pour une livraison encore plus rapide.

Comment fonctionne la messagerie en temps réel ?

CRM Chat utilise un système hybride à 3 niveaux : SSE comme transport principal avec environ 1 seconde de latence, le badge-polling en secours, et le support optionnel Pusher WebSocket pour une livraison instantanée. Aucune configuration nécessaire — ça fonctionne automatiquement.

Est-il adapté aux mobiles ?

Oui. CRM Chat est entièrement responsive à partir d'une largeur de 390px, avec des contrôles optimisés pour le tactile et une expérience similaire à une application. Il fonctionne parfaitement avec le module Flavor pour le mode sombre.

Quels types de fichiers peuvent être partagés ?

Les types de fichiers et la taille maximale sont configurables dans les paramètres d'administration. Par défaut : PNG, JPG, GIF, PDF, DOC, DOCX, XLS, XLSX, ZIP, MP3 et MP4 avec une limite de 10 Mo.

S'intègre-t-il avec les autres fonctionnalités de Perfex CRM ?

Oui. Tu peux sélectionner plusieurs messages de chat et les convertir en ticket de support en un clic. CRM Chat utilise également le système existant de staff et de permissions de Perfex avec 6 permissions granulaires.

Combien d'utilisateurs simultanés sont pris en charge ?

Chaque connexion SSE active utilise un processus PHP worker. Le nombre de chatteurs simultanés dépend de la configuration de ton serveur. Pour les grandes équipes, active Pusher pour réduire significativement la charge serveur.

CRM Chat est-il conforme au RGPD ?

Oui. Toutes les données restent sur ton serveur — aucun appel API externe n'est effectué. Les messages utilisent la suppression douce pour les pistes d'audit, et tu peux configurer le nettoyage automatique des messages après un nombre de jours défini.

Puis-je déplacer le widget de chat ?

Oui. Le widget de chat est déplaçable par glisser-déposer — positionne-le n'importe où sur la page. La position est sauvegardée dans ton navigateur et persiste après le rechargement.

Is CRM Chat GDPR compliant?

Yes. All data stays on your server — no external API calls are made. Messages use soft-delete for audit trails, and you can configure automatic message cleanup after a specified number of days.

Can I move the chat widget?

Yes. The floating chat widget is fully draggable — just click and drag it to any position on the page. Your position is saved in the browser and persists across page reloads. This is useful when the widget overlaps important buttons like "Save Invoice".

Besoin d'aide ?

Contacte notre équipe de support ou visite la page du module.